Unleashing the Power of APIs in Forex – A Guide for Traders

Imagine this: You’re a skilled Forex trader, constantly monitoring charts, analyzing news, and executing trades. But wouldn’t it be amazing to automate some of these mundane tasks, freeing up your time for strategic decision-making? This is where Application Programming Interfaces, or APIs, enter the picture – offering the potential to revolutionize your trading experience.

Unleashing the Power of APIs in Forex – A Guide for Traders
Image: fcsapi.com

In this comprehensive guide, we’ll delve into the world of APIs in Forex, unraveling their complexities and exploring how these powerful tools can empower your trading journey.

What are Forex APIs and Why are They Important?

Imagine Forex trading as a vast, intricate machine. APIs act as the connectors, enabling communication between different systems and components within that machine. Think of them as the invisible threads weaving together the complex tapestry of the Forex market.

At their core, Forex APIs are essentially sets of rules and specifications that allow software applications to talk to each other. These rules dictate how data is shared, processed, and communicated between different trading platforms, brokers, and external tools.

For traders, the significance lies in the incredible possibilities that APIs unlock:

  • Automate Trading Strategies: Instead of manually placing orders, APIs can be used to execute trades automatically based on predefined parameters or complex algorithms. This frees up time for deeper analysis and allows traders to capitalize on fleeting market opportunities.
  • Access Real-time Data: APIs can directly connect to data feeds, providing real-time market information, news updates, and economic indicators. This gives traders a significant edge, enabling them to react swiftly and make informed decisions.
  • Build Custom Trading Tools: APIs empower traders to develop their own personalized trading applications, designed to meet their specific needs and trading styles. This allows for tailored solutions, including custom indicators, risk management tools, and charting platforms.
  • Streamline Trading Operations: APIs can connect different trading platforms, brokers, and data providers, streamlining workflows and reducing manual data entry. The result: a more efficient and streamlined trading experience.
Read:   Iq Option No Deposit Bonus: A Guide For Traders

A Deep Dive into the World of Forex APIs

To truly grasp the power of Forex APIs, we need to delve deeper into their workings:

1. API Types and Applications

  • Market Data APIs: These APIs provide access to real-time market data, including prices, bid/ask spreads, and trade volume. Essential for any trader seeking to stay informed and react swiftly to market movements.
  • Trading APIs: These APIs allow traders to connect their trading platforms to brokers, enabling automatic order execution and account management. They are the backbone of algorithmic trading and automated strategies.
  • Account Management APIs: These APIs simplify account operations by allowing traders to manage their accounts, view balances and positions, and access trade history through external applications.

2. Understanding API Communication

At its core, API communication relies on a simple request-response mechanism.

  • Request: When a trader interacts with an API-enabled application, they send a request containing specific information, such as a trade order or a data query.
  • Response: The Forex broker’s server receives the request, processes it, and sends back a response, providing the requested information or confirming the order execution.

3. Key API Concepts for Forex Traders

  • Authentication: To prevent unauthorized access, most Forex APIs require authentication, ensuring that only authorized users can interact with the system.
  • Documentation: Comprehensive documentation is crucial for understanding how to interact with a specific API. It outlines the available functions, parameters, and error codes, guiding developers in building custom applications.
  • Rate Limiting: To manage server load and ensure fair access, Forex brokers often impose limits on the number of API calls a user can make within a specific timeframe.
Read:   Descifrando el lenguaje secreto de las velas – Una guía para principiantes sobre los patrones de velas

Harnessing the Power of APIs: Practical Applications

Now, let’s explore specific use cases, illustrating how Forex APIs can be utilized to enhance your trading:

1. Building Automated Trading Systems:

  • Trend-Following Strategy: Develop an algorithm that automatically places trades based on price momentum, adjusting entry and exit points based on predefined parameters.
  • News Triggered Trading: Combine market data APIs with news feeds to execute trades based on specific news events, capturing market reactions in real-time.

2. Streamlining Trade Execution and Risk Management:

  • Stop-Loss and Take-Profit Orders: Automatically set stop-loss and take-profit orders based on predefined price levels, minimizing losses and securing profits.
  • Position Sizing: Calculate optimal position sizes based on your risk tolerance, market volatility, and account balance, reducing the impact of individual trades on your overall portfolio.

3. Data Analysis and Visualization:

  • Custom Indicators: Develop unique indicators and trading tools to analyze market trends and identify potential trading opportunities.
  • Real-time Market Visualization: Create custom dashboards that display real-time market data, charting patterns, and economic indicators, providing a comprehensive view of the market.

API Trading Forex Platform for Arbitrage
Image: westernpips.pro

Expert Insights for Success with Forex APIs

1. Security and Reliability:

  • Choose Reputable Brokers: Opt for regulated brokers with a proven track record of security and reliability, ensuring the safety of your trading data and funds.
  • Test Thoroughly: Before implementing any API-based system in live trading, test it extensively in a simulated environment to identify any potential flaws or errors.

2. Understanding Your Needs:

  • Define Your Trading Style: Determine your specific trading goals, risk tolerance, and preferred strategies before selecting an API and developing applications.
  • Start Small: Begin by implementing simple API-based solutions, gradually expanding your usage as you gain experience and confidence.
Read:   Google Cloud Tunnel – Unlocking Secure and Reliable Remote Access

What Is Api In Forex

Conclusion: Embracing the Power of APIs

Forex APIs have the potential to transform your trading journey, offering a level of automation, customization, and data access that was previously unimaginable. By embracing these tools, you can unlock powerful capabilities, streamline your operations, and gain a competitive edge in the dynamic world of Forex trading.

The future of Forex trading is undeniably digital, and APIs are at the forefront of this evolution. So, embark on your own API adventure, explore the possibilities, and unleash the full potential of your trading expertise.


You May Also Like